Step 1
To make the congee, combine oil, ginger, garlic & spring onions in a large non-stick saucepan over medium-high heat. Stir fry until aromatics are golden & fragrant.
Step 2
Add rice & chicken stock. Bring to a boil, add the chicken breast then reduce to a simmer to cook until the rice has broken down (about 40 minutes) to a thick soup (or your preferred consistency).
Step 3
Keep an eye on the chicken & remove when it is cooked through, shred with 2 forks or fingers and set aside. If the congee is a little thick add more chicken stock or water.
Step 4
Towards the end, taste your congee and add fish sauce for saltiness.
Step 5
Garnish with bean sprouts, spring onion, snipped Youtiao (Chinese donut) as pictured, coriander, ground pepper, fried shallots and chilli.
